Advanced Engine Technologies

One of the most significant improvements is in engine technology. Many 2025 truck models will feature advanced turbocharged engines that utilize direct fuel injection and improved combustion techniques. These engines provide more power while using less fuel, leading to better miles per gallon (MPG) ratings. For instance, some trucks are expected to achieve up to 25% better fuel efficiency compared to their predecessors, translating to substantial savings at the pump.

Hybrid and Electric Options

In response to growing consumer demand for greener alternatives, manufacturers are also introducing hybrid and fully electric truck models. While hybrid trucks combine traditional internal combustion engines with electric propulsion to improve fuel efficiency, fully electric trucks offer zero emissions and significantly lower operating costs. For example, an electric truck can cost as little as $0.02 per mile to operate, compared to $0.10 or more for conventional diesel trucks. This shift towards electrification represents a significant step forward in the effort to reduce the carbon footprint of the trucking industry.

Streamlined Aerodynamic Designs

The 2025 trucks are being designed with aerodynamics in mind. Features such as improved front grilles, streamlined bodies, and optimized undercarriages help reduce drag, allowing trucks to glide more efficiently through the air. This reduction in aerodynamic drag can lead to fuel efficiency gains of up to 15%, making a noticeable difference for truck owners who rely on their vehicles for long-distance travel or heavy-duty hauling.

Use of Lightweight Materials

In addition to aerodynamic improvements, the use of lightweight materials, such as high-strength aluminum and advanced composites, is becoming increasingly common in truck construction. By reducing the overall weight of the vehicle, manufacturers can enhance fuel efficiency without sacrificing strength or durability. A lighter truck requires less energy to operate, directly impacting fuel consumption. This focus on weight reduction is expected to yield improvements of 5% to 10% in fuel efficiency for many models.

Cost Savings for Truck Owners

For consumers, the most immediate benefit of improved fuel efficiency is the reduction in fuel costs. With gas prices fluctuating, achieving better MPG ratings can lead to significant savings over time. For instance, if a truck owner drives an average of 20,000 miles per year and sees a 25% increase in fuel efficiency, they could save upwards of $1,000 annually—considering average fuel prices and consumption patterns.

Reduced Emissions and Environmental Benefits

From an environmental perspective, the shift towards more fuel-efficient trucks is crucial in addressing climate change. Improved fuel efficiency translates into lower greenhouse gas emissions, contributing to cleaner air and a healthier planet. The introduction of hybrid and electric trucks further accelerates this positive trend, as they produce little to no emissions during operation. As a result, the trucking industry is moving closer to meeting stringent environmental regulations and playing its part in achieving national sustainability goals.
